Libya launches major security operation in Zawiya after clashes near key oil refinery
In Zawiya, home to one of the oil-rich country’s biggest refineries, rival gangs clash over the trafficking of fuel and commercial goods into neighbouring Tunisia.

WorldAIUS Secretary of State Marco Rubio confirmed ongoing talks with Denmark and Greenland regarding collective defense and missile defense on the island. This follows President Trump's repeated assertions of Greenland's strategic importance and desire for US acquisition, despite strong opposition from Greenlanders.

PoliticsAIPina Picierno, Vice President of the European Parliament, has left the Italian Democratic Party and the center-left group to join the liberal Renew Europe group. She cited ambiguity on Ukraine and Putin's war as reasons for her departure, criticizing the party's increasingly populist stance.
